WORKSHOP
Leadership and Strategies to Enhance Parents’ Commitment
An interactive workshop explored concrete courses of action that could be used to address various challenges faced by parents’ associations.
After a dynamic presentation that aroused interest and launched discussion, presenter Christine McLeod invited the delegates to work in small groups.
Participants were called upon to do two things in particular. On the one hand, each person had to identify a particular challenge affecting their community; one that could benefit from the experiences of other members of the group. On the other hand, they had to identify an achievement or expertise acquired by their own parents’ association, so that they could share proven best practices that might benefit other communities.

The workshop gave rise to lively discussions, generating practical solutions and inspiring ideas which flowed into the exchange of information -- and all this, well after the end of the workshop which was very much appreciated by the participants!
